There's an energy here for sure, but there's many issues. This is a highly conservative arrangement. Outside of the percussion it's nearly identical to the original source. This is also repetitive to the point that it honestly gets tiresome before we even get to the 2 minute mark. The original isn't very long before it fully loops too (~50 seconds). I would suggest to add some of your own interpretation or change-up some elements from the source. Not only will that help with the repetition but it will add one of the biggest missing elements from this piece: your own unique interpretation and ideas. Having a drop at 1:40 was a good idea, but it's still just playing the same thing, just with less parts. The texture and dynamic contrast is good, but we need some new ideas! Consider adding more textural shifts later into the track or cut repeats to reduce the repetitiveness. The drums don't have much punch to them and honestly feel over compressed. In terms of sound design much of the synths are very plain and vanilla. They could be much more sophisticated and interesting sounding. I don't like to say anything straight up doesn't sound good, but the whistle that enters at 1:53 is unpleasant. Not only does it stand out, but it lasts a long while, it just keeps going and takes a while before we get a break from it. I like the energy you're trying to bring, but there's simply too many problems as is. NO

Certainly a fun idea doing a remix fully on a Yamaha RM1x! Begins with a fadeout straight into the source's intro. You use a standard beat here rather than whatever the percussion is doing on the original. That said, the drums sound quite dull with almost no punch and their writing isn't particularly varied (there's a snare fill you use A LOT during the track). Source usage is super conservative, with the remix following the original's structure with no variations until the break at 1:40. On the section around 0:55 I hear some artifacts on the track, almost as if it was clipping. Break around 1:40 is very appreciated as something fresh but then at 1:54 you bring a very high pitched sound that's honestly very annoying to hear... and it plays for a loooong time. There's some cool ideas and variations on this section but they're almost drowned by that one annoying sound. After this the arrangemet basically repeats itself and then on the end it noodles over the main riff. On arrangement this needs more work to fit OCR's standards. Outside of the section starting at 1:40 the entire remix is basically doing the source 1:1 with a different percussion. Besides from that the arrangement is extremely repetitive, overusing the main motifs of the source. As prophetik said, there's definitely space to either change up how you use the original's riffs or to simply cut the length. On production the track shows the limitations of the way it was made. Sounds are dated, most synths are very simple and unexciting. Drums lack punch and the writing doesn't help, repeating the same beats and fills for most of the track. There's some synth samples that are extremely heavy on high frequencies and get very grating, like the arpeggios on the main riff and the annoying sample at 1:54. Overall, this isn't near the bar for OCR yet. There's fun ideas here, especially on the 1:40 section, but both arrangement and production need refinement. NO

Lovely arrangement and performance, it _feels_ very jnWake to me <3 This source feels like it moves in a way that reflects how you navigate chord changes and flowing melody lines in your other arrangements, so this is an obvious fit! Pretty much co-signing Joe's vote here - there's way too much spikyness in the low end of the piano that's eating up headroom and honestly sounds like it's being distorted when it hits the compressor. Is there some analog emulation going on or some saturation involved here? I don't think I love the effect it's having. If you want, I can take a stab at cleaning this up if you can send me MIDI! I have the same piano library you used, but I think some Soothe 2 could go a long way to reduce some of the sharp spikes on the low end of the piano. But if not, I do think that a gentle shelf on the low end of the piano to reduce that low end dominance, or maybe changing the microphone position in the library so that it's slightly further away, would be a good starting point. It sounds miniscule, but for a solo piano piece, especially one played this way, you're doing a disservice to your performance to have the left hand part taking up so much of the spotlight. I think this will sound a lot better with some cleanup! NO (resubmit!) -
